The Liteonit LCM-256 256GB averaged just 19.9% lower than the peak scores attained by the group leaders. This is an excellent result which ranks the Liteonit LCM-256 256GB near the top of the comparison list.

Excellent consistency

The range of scores (95th - 5th percentile) for the Liteonit LCM-256 256GB is just 7.39%. This is an extremely narrow range which indicates that the Liteonit LCM-256 256GB performs superbly consistently under varying real world conditions.

Welcome to our 2.5" and M.2 SSD comparison. We calculate effective speed for both SATA and NVMe drives based on real world performance then adjust by current prices per GB to yield a value for money rating. Our calculated values are checked against thousands of individual user ratings. The customizable table below combines these factors to bring you the definitive list of top SSDs. [SSDrivePro]
